More than 300 people arrested during May Day protests in Istanbul
![]() 1038 Thursday, 01 May, 2025, 15:33 Clashes between May Day protesters and police broke out in Istanbul. The organizers of the demonstrations, trade unionists and students, demanded guarantees for their rights and decent work. Despite the peaceful and non-political nature of the demonstrations, the Istanbul police brutally dispersed the demonstration. More than 300 people have already been arrested. |
